Nice for extra tall bottles

MyPenNameSeptember 22, 2016

The overall size and capacity of this caddy is not extra large, at least as far as I am concerned. I have had other caddies in the past that hold a lot more items. The "large" area of this one is the height between the two shelves which allows it to accomodate the really tall bottles. As far as the width and depth of the shelves, I'd say they are just normal. Mine was missing the rubber piece to use on the hanger to keep it from slipping and suction cups alone never seem to be enough to keep a caddy in place, especially when it is full. The construction is nice and I do really like the satin finish opposed to chrome because let's face it, chrome or stainless only stays shiny and pretty looking for so long especially when you have hard water. I do not want to spend time cleaning and scrubbing a shower caddy ... cleaning the shower and tub is a chore enough! So, anyway, the satin finish looks nice but sort of hides any water marks, etc. I like that there are several hooks for sponges and tools. I have loofas, sponges, pumice stones, soap on a roap type mesh bar soap bag thingies, back scrubber brush.. lots of bath goodies, so i always appreciate extra hooks. I actually have an 'over the door' coat hook rack thing hanging over my shower rod, with the hooks side inside of the shower and have sponges etc hanging on there as well (handy dandy idea there). So, while this caddy looks nice and seems well made, you may want to choose a different one if you truly want an extra large size caddy that can hold a lot of items. Do you typically have 7 body washes, 3 face scrubs, 2 cleansers, and 3 sets of shampoo and conditioner, a few Lush cakes and a couple random body scrubs in the shower? If yes, you will want a different caddy :) This one does not accomodate my bath arsenal. Read more

This thing is very large! Make sure you look at measurements and spec it for your shower application. I was going to use this in my boy's bathroom which has a typical hosed, handheld showerhead. It didn't fit for that application well because this organizer stood out so far from the tub wall it pushed on the hose for the shower head. I then put it in my shower even though it does not match my hardware :(. My husband and I have far more (and larger sized) shower soaps/shampoos/body washes, razors, conditioners, nail cleaners, etc. Our large size body wash and shampoos are pump topped and they would only fit on the top shelf of this unit which leaves them placed so high we have to take them out to use them and put them back in the rack. There are just 2 razor hangers and 2 hooks (total) for wash cloths or body buffs and shower squeegees. There is no area for our bar soap on this rack so we use a soap dish. Our other caddy had a soap bar holder, but we chose to use a separate dish anyway so this is not a big deal for us. The rack signage stated it was coated to prevent rusting; hopefully that will work. If it starts to rust I will throw it out for sure. It did come with suction cups on the bottom, but they do not adhere to our tile wall at all. We have had many such shower caddies over the years and most of the suction cups have not worked except occasionally when we had slick marble walls in one of our showers. The white plastic coated caddies have historically been the quickest to rust and thus have had the shortest life span. This caddy is replacing a perfectly fine (albeit a tad small) oil rubbed bronze caddy that remains in perfect condition at almost 3 years old. I think these shower caddies are a great organizational shower accessory. This one did come with anti slip pin-like a cotter pin which snapped on over the shower pipe after you hang the shower caddy. This anti slip pin was attached in a small plastic bag to the back of the caddy. Its' application is critical to stabilize the caddy on the shower head pipe so that it does not slip down and fall off! On the top shelf are three 1" round holes so that if a top could fit, you could invert a bottle (upside down) so it would be easier to use up the remainder in the bottle. Read more
